Can. Dark brown. The aroma is, I mean there's a lot of cumin and a lot of chile in there. On the palate, same. The cumin is dominant - and of course a mole doesn't showcase any one ingredient as it's intended as a blend of 20 or more. The chiles are odd - there is a greenness to the chile character that is definitely out of place. Given the price of stupid dried chiles in Vancouver, it doesn't surprise me that there might be some green ones in here, but it's definitely not ideal. The flavours, as odd as they are, are nevertheless in balance.
